Full Journal pdf2011-03-10 House Journal Page 0426 HB 103 The House Special Committee on Energy considered: HOUSE BILL NO. 103 "An Act relating to the procurement of supplies, services, professional services, and construction for the Alaska Energy Authority; establishing the Alaska Railbelt energy fund and relating to the fund; relating to and repealing the Railbelt energy fund; relating to the quorum of the board of the Alaska Energy Authority; relating to the powers of the Alaska Energy Authority regarding employees and the transfer of certain employees of the Alaska Industrial Development Export Authority to the Alaska Energy Authority; relating to acquiring or constructing certain projects by the Alaska Energy Authority; relating to the definition of 'feasibility study' in the Alaska Energy Authority Act; and providing for an effective date." and recommends it be replaced with: CS FOR HOUSE BILL NO. 103(ENE) "An Act establishing the Alaska Railbelt energy fund and relating to the fund; relating to and repealing the Railbelt energy fund; relating to the quorum of the Alaska Energy Authority; relating to the powers of the Alaska Energy Authority regarding employees and the transfer of certain employees of the Alaska Industrial Development Export Authority to the Alaska Energy Authority; relating to the acquisition or construction of certain projects by the Alaska Energy Authority; relating to the definition of 'feasibility study' in the Alaska Energy Authority Act; and providing for an effective date." The report was signed by Representatives Pruitt and Foster, Co-chairs, with the following individual recommendations: Do pass (7): Olson, Lynn, Tuck, Petersen, Saddler, Pruitt, Foster The following fiscal note(s) apply to CSHB 103(ENE): 2011-03-10 House Journal Page 0427 1.
